BBY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2019 in Review

609 of the 4,560 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Best Buy (BBY) for Q3 2019, worth a combined $13.9B — down 13% from $15.9B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 67 funds opened new BBY positions and 65 closed out — a net gain of 2 holders — while 214 added to existing stakes and 234 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Boston Partners, opening a new position worth an estimated $124M. The largest seller was Skandinaviska Enskilda Banken (SEB), cutting an estimated $104M.
